QX Resources Ltd ( (AU:QXR) ) has shared an update.
QX Resources Ltd has convened a general meeting of shareholders to be held in Perth on 1 April 2026, with the notice of meeting made available electronically rather than via physical mail-outs, except for investors who have opted for hard copies. The company is urging shareholders to use online proxy voting ahead of the deadline, reflecting a continued shift toward digital communication and participation in corporate governance processes.
Shareholders are directed to obtain meeting materials from the company’s website, ASX page, or via emailed links, and are encouraged to provide email addresses for future electronic communications. The emphasis on timely proxy lodgement and electronic access underscores QX Resources’ efforts to streamline shareholder engagement and ensure broad participation in key decisions despite reduced reliance on paper-based correspondence.
